Re: Someone running scripts?
Can't you input a script in the game which detects the intervals during which different targets get hit? Even the best farmer/raider who is human takes minimal a certain amount of time which an script (which isn't bound to the speed with which hands move and keyboards which need to react) has not, and thus hits faster. Also, the time an human takes to hit varies (due to getting slight tiredness in the hands etc already) which a script has not.
Of course, you can put it in an 'random interval' in a script, but that would in the end beat the purpose of the script.

Re: Someone running scripts?
BenjaminMS wrote:Can't you input a script in the game which detects the intervals during which different targets get hit? Even the best farmer/raider who is human takes minimal a certain amount of time which an script (which isn't bound to the speed with which hands move and keyboards which need to react) has not, and thus hits faster. Also, the time an human takes to hit varies (due to getting slight tiredness in the hands etc already) which a script has not.
Of course, you can put it in an 'random interval' in a script, but that would in the end beat the purpose of the script.
Reactions, other input?
The time a script takes to hit also varies, depending on availability of naq on the battlefield and game speed.
As for them being faster - that's not quite always so Besides, regardless of how fast they might be, I'm guessing they are also subject to the 'no more than 6 attacks in 2 seconds' rule, and I know it slowed me down on many occasions. They don't need to be extraordinarily fast, they have all the time in the world.
